The University of Mary Washington volleyball team won a pair of matches at the Lynchburg College Tournament on Friday evening. The Eagles topped Randolph, 25-17, 26-24, 25-15 before a stirring comeback from an 0-2 deficit to down Johns Hopkins, 23-25, 22-25, 25-18, 28-2, 15-13. UMW moves to 7-1 on the year.

In the win over Randolph, freshman Hannah Lawson (Charlottesville, Va., Albemarle) went 11-15 on kill attempts without an error, and also added seven digs, while sophomore Laura Gomez (Charlottesville, Va., Albemarle) added six kills. Sophomore Ellen Smethurst (Charlottesville, Va., Covenant School) added 4-7 on kill attempts, and junior Tola Adebanjo (Overland Park, Ks., Blue Valley Northwest) had six kills. Junior Katie Shiflett (Weyers Cave, Va., Fort Defiance) scored 12 assists and nine aces, and freshman Sammy Hogue (Springfield, Va., West Springfield) added nine assists.

In the come from behind win over Johns Hopkins, Gomez went 15-35 with one error, Lawson added 12 kills, and Adbanjo posted 10 kills. Smethurst had six kills and six blocks, Shiflett had 33 assists and 10 digs, and Karissa Herrick (Colts Neck, N.J., Colts Neck) scored seven blocks. Kaitlynn Wickersham (Midlothian, Va., Manchester) added 17 digs to lead the Eagles.

UMW will continue at the Lynchburg Tournament on Saturday morning.
